From the main channel turning in towards Coosa island, you should be on the left side of the "red house on the island" after you pass the red house, you should stay on the left side of the little knoll with the bouies lying on it. "The pier 59 side" the water on the other side of that little knoll is only about 1 - 2 ft deep in one little strip across there. and if you want another reference point theres a pier that is made out of what appears to be pvc pipe thats a good marker for about where the shallow strip is i've seen 2 or 3 boats get in trouble right there already.
